Socially responsible purchasing has a positive impact on the performance, trust and
cooperation of the supplier base. The likely impact would be felt by both the sponsor
company and the supplier organisations. In conversations with practitioners in the sponsor
company, cost and difficulty to implement were frequently cited as reasons for purchasing
and supply managers’ reluctance to participate in such activities. The literature review has
also revealed that there is a dearth of practicable methodologies for implementing CSR in
the purchasing environment. If a methodology could be developed to allow ethical
purchasing practices, it would mean that a supplier could invest in improvements to
infrastructure, reaching higher levels of performance and quality at lower costs.
The study featured in this paper has outlined a process for the evaluation of an automotive
organisation’s suppliers by CSR measures. The CSR evaluation process identified which
suppliers should be considered for the CSR audit. This process is significant because it
gave the purchasing manager, of the sponsor organisation, an objective basis for
decision-making. The process outlined provides a questionnaire and scoring and
weighting functionality delivered through an integrated tool.
The responses from the organisation and of the evaluation panel validate this methodology
in both academic rigor and real-world industrial practice. A number of pointers for the future
development of the CSR evaluation process are also provided by this panel. In particular,
mention is given to the opportunity of integrating the tool more closely with strategy and
policy procedures of an organisation. There is scope for the further development of the tool
through its use in sectors beyond the automotive industry, such as the retail sector. The
retail industry, as a sector for further study, also offers the possibility to integrate customer
purchasing habits and opinions into the CSR evaluation process, leading to the potential
identification of innovative product combinations sourced from otherwise overlooked niche
suppliers.
